Access to this collection is generously supported by Arcadia funds. Dr. Ellen Fitz Pendleton, president of Wellesley College, during a visit to Southern California. Pendleton was a nationally known leader in education. A different photograph of Dr. Ellen Fitz Pendleton taken on the same occasion appears with the article, "Today's Young Women Exel Grandmothers, Says Wellesley Head," Los Angeles Times, 17 Nov. 1932: pg A1. Handwritten on negative: Dr. Ellen Fitz Pendleton Text from negative sleeve: Pendleton, Ellen Fitz Dr. Wellesley Col.1932
